U+8366 "荦"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a Chinese character that primarily means "noticeable" or "prominent," often used in classical literary contexts to describe something that stands out or is conspicuous. It is also associated with the concept of "brilliance" or "markedness," and appears in compound words like 荦荦 (luòluò), which denotes something that is very clear or outstanding. The character is composed of the radical for "grass" (艹) and the phonetic component 牢, and it has been part of the standard CJK (Chinese, Japanese, and Korean) set of ideographs for decades. In modern usage, it is relatively rare but is still found in formal writing, historical texts, or personal names.
